Renaissance: A Cultural Rebirth The Renaissance was a period of immense artistic and intellectual growth in Europe, spanning the 14th to the 17th century. It's characterized by a renewed interest in classical art, humanism, and scientific advancements. Studying the works of Renaissance masters like Leonardo da Vinci and Michelangelo can provide valuable insights into this transformative era. 2. Monologue: A Solo Performance In drama, a monologue is a speech delivered by a single character, often revealing their thoughts, emotions, or intentions. It's a powerful tool for actors to showcase their range and depth, and it's frequently used in auditions and performances. 3. Crescendo: Building Musical Intensity Crescendo, an Italian term, means to gradually increase the volume or intensity of a musical passage. It's denoted by the symbol '<', and it's a technique used by composers to create tension, drama, and impact in their compositions. 4. Impressionism: Capturing Fleeting Moments
